Staphylococcus aureus; is most often associated with being a:

a) Respiratory pathogen
b) Gastrointestinal pathogen
c) Skin and wound pathogen
d) Urinary tract pathogen

Final answer:

Staphylococcus aureus is most commonly associated with being a skin and wound pathogen, causing various infections in the skin and other body systems.

Step-by-step explanation:

Staphylococcus aureus is most often associated with being a skin and wound pathogen. It commonly causes skin infections such as folliculitis, furuncles, carbuncles, and staphylococcal scalded skin syndrome (SSSS). Additionally, S. aureus is a leading cause of staphylococcal infections in various body systems.
